Sananda Marandi re-elected deputy speaker of Odisha assembly

The three-time legislator was elected unopposed by a voice vote after his name was proposed by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ik as no other candidate was fielded by any other political party against him.
The BJD won 117 seats in the 147-member assembly in the 2014 polls held simultaneously with the Lok Sabha elections.
Marandi, 41, was re-elected from the Baripada constituency. He was also the deputy speaker of the state assembly from 2011-2014.
